This Pub is Closed Long Term
Historic Interest
Grade B Listed, Historic Environment Scotland reference LB26304. Originally late 18th century & three storeys when it may have been known as the Sun Tavern. It was combined into a single two storey pub in the late 19th century. Photos show it as the 'Queen of the South Bar' in 1948, 'Baker Street' in 2009, 'Wh? Not' in 2014/15, and 'Queen of the South' again in 2018. In early 2020 the lease was up or sale with the signage a 'blank canvas' waiting for another name.
